Once the UART has buffered enough data to send (either regUARTMTU bytes received or regTXTO has
expired), it will schedule a transmission with the RF layer. The RF layer will make a best-effort attempt to
keep the data in at least regUARTMTU-sized packets, but will split data to better fill the communications
channel if the hop time allows. If the module is not synchronized at the time of the transmission, it votes
itself to master status, and sends a synchronizing preamble. Following a hop, the module that sends the
first transmission will vote itself to master status, send a synchronizing preamble, and communications will
resume.
2.3. Low-Power States
The module supports three power saving modes: Standby, Sleep, and Deep Sleep. Standby and Sleep
are included primarily for legacy compatibility with Wi.232DTS™ and Wi.232EUR™ products. The
hardware required to support these two low-power modes fully is not present in the Wi.232FHSS modules.
As a result, the current consumption in these two modes is considerably higher than their
Wi.232DTS™/Wi.232EUR™ counterparts. It is recommended that applications utilize the Deep Sleep
mode for power savings.
In the SLEEP and DEEP SLEEP modes, the transceiver is powered down and will not synchronize with
other modules. SLEEP mode draws more current than DEEP SLEEP mode. In DEEP SLEEP mode the
module draws the least current. To wake the module up from this mode the C2CK/RST pin must be held
low for at least 20
μs and then returned to high. Modules do not monitor the receive channel in either
SLEEP or DEEP SLEEP mode. Therefore, it is impossible to remotely wake a sleeping module via the RF
interface.
If regACKONWAKE is enabled, the module will transmit a 0x06 character out the TxD pin of the UART
once awakened from a low-power mode or power-off state. This indicates that the module is ready to
resume operations.
